How to get inode count of a filesystem on Solaris/Unix?


I was invoking the following command and reading the outpup df -F ufs -o i. It worked fine initially but then started to fail for the reason reported and explained here http://wesunsolve.net/bugid/id/6795242.

Although the solution suggested on the above link might work but it is ugly and I want a permanent solution. So, really looking for c api on Solaris/Unix that would give me the total and available number of inodes given a filesystem.

Solution

  • The statvfs system call can be used to retrieve file system statistics including the number of total inodes and the number of free inodes. Use the system call to retrieve a statvfs structure and then inspect the f_files and f_ffree fields to determine the number of inodes and the number of free inodes, respectively.

    Example:

    #include <statvfs.h>
    
    struct statvfs buffer;
    int            status;
    fsfilcnt_t     total_inodes;
    fsfilcnt_t     free_inodes;
    ...
    status = statvfs("/home/betaylor/file_in_filesystem", &buffer);
    
    total_inodes = buffer.f_files;
    free_inodes  = buffer.f_ffree;
    ...
